Output 8768b86c766fc63c906bd138b5a6e3a2d27742e9a772458bdf854dd623b54ad9:1

value
5650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88cbd53345f2db865416becaa3eef9fffbaf3fa OP_EQUAL
address
3KyRffYCe8xdELhXAsVM6bkBwH6mX7wB8Z
transaction
8768b86c766fc63c906bd138b5a6e3a2d27742e9a772458bdf854dd623b54ad9
spent
true